Makeovers seem to be the latest trend in the world of railway stations in India. Mumbai, Jodhpur, Jaipur, Chennai, and more – stations across the country are getting swanky walls with beautiful paintings, clean platforms, colourful stairs, and a very welcoming environment. The beautification everywhere is being done by citizens and the government alike. There are NGOs, students, volunteers, government organizations and many others who just want their stations to look fabulous – instead of giving the same dull feeling we usually get on entering a station.
